U.S. Marines, Soldiers, Airmen and Australian soldiers conduct the basic airborne refresher course June 19 at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son, Alaska, before performing a rehearsal for Talisman Sabre 15. Prior to a live jump, all service members are required to complete the basic airborne refresher as well as practice parachute landing falls. Talisman Sabre is an exercise designed to improve U.S. and Australian combat training, readiness and interoperability. The service members are a part of Pacific Command’s Combined Task Force 660.
